- Lai Ching-te said on a U.S. radio show that President Trump would deserve a Nobel Peace Prize if he persuaded Xi Jinping to renounce the use of force against Taiwan.
- China’s Taiwan Affairs Office accused Lai of “unprincipled foreign pandering,” said he was “prostituting himself,” and warned that reliance on foreign forces to seek independence is doomed.
- The statement labeled Lai a separatist and declared that he and pro-independence forces would be “swept into the dustbin of history.”
- Reporters noted that the language used by Beijing was unusually strong for official Chinese communications.
- The exchange comes ahead of Lai’s national day speech, and Taiwan’s defense ministry separately reported increased Chinese military activity and AI-enabled “hybrid warfare” targeting the island.
